A common mistake is evaluating a lawn care provider exclusively by the color of the lawn. In 2026, the real test of quality is what is taking place below the surface. Relied on specialists will frequently show house owners the root depth of their grass. Long, thick roots are an indication of correct watering and aeration, whereas brief, spindly roots recommend over-watering or extreme fertilization.In your specific region, specialists handle particular bugs that may have migrated due to changing climate zones. An expert can determine the early indications of grub invasions or fungal illness before they brown out large patches of the lawn. They utilize integrated pest management (IPM) strategies, which focus on biological controls and mechanical fixes before turning to sprays. This targeted approach is much safer for family pets and kids who invest time outdoors.
The relationship between a property owner and a lawn expert ought to be a partnership. A relied on supplier will interact clearly about the seasonal needs of the backyard. For instance, in the local market, the timing for aeration and overseeding is a narrow window. A quality service will reach out weeks ahead of time to set up these tasks, discussing why they are necessary for the upcoming season.They ought to also be honest about what a yard can and can not attain. If a backyard has too much shade or the soil is too compacted, a good expert won't simply keep tossing seed at the problem. They will recommend alternatives, such as shade-tolerant ground covers or altering the grade of the land to improve drainage. This honesty conserves the homeowner cash in the long run and avoids the disappointment of a stopping working yard.
